The role of relays in new energy vehicles: a comparison with traditional fuel vehicles

post time:2024-04-12 23:34:51 author:Free Little Bird clicks:1995 【 Size:big middle small

With the continuous progress of science and technology, new energy vehicles have gradually entered people's field of vision and have attracted widespread attention for their advantages of environmental protection, energy saving, and intelligence. Among the many technologies of new energy vehicles, relays, as an important control element, play a crucial role in new energy vehicles. This article will focus on the role of relays in new energy vehicles and compare their applications in traditional fuel vehicles.

First, we need to understand the basic working principle of relays. A relay is a switching device that realizes circuit control through electromagnetic principles, and its internal coils and contacts are included. When the coil is energized, the generated magnetic field causes the contacts to close or disconnect, enabling control of the circuit. In new energy vehicles, relays are mainly used in the switching control of high-voltage circuits and the protection of electrical systems. 

In new energy vehicles, the role of relays is mainly reflected in the following aspects: 

1. High-voltage circuit control

New energy vehicles use high-voltage direct current as the power source, and relays play a key role in the control of high-voltage circuits. By controlling the on/off of the relay, the start-stop control of high-voltage equipment such as power batteries, motors, and chargers is realized to ensure the safe operation of high-voltage circuits. 

2. Electrical system protection 

Relays play the role of protective devices in the electrical system of new energy vehicles. When the electrical system has abnormal conditions such as overcurrent and overvoltage, the relay can quickly cut off the circuit and prevent equipment damage and safety accidents.

3. Intelligent control coordination 

The intelligent control system of new energy vehicles achieves real-time monitoring and precise control of vehicle status by integrating various sensors, controllers and actuators. As one of the actuators, the relay can work together with other intelligent control components to jointly realize the intelligent control of the vehicle. 

In contrast, traditional fuel vehicles are relatively simple in terms of electrical system control. Since fuel vehicles mainly rely on fuel engines to provide power, the electrical system is mainly responsible for basic functions such as ignition, lighting, and air conditioning. Therefore, the application of relays in fuel vehicles is mainly focused on low- voltage circuit control, such as ignition coils, lighting control, etc.

However, with the continuous development of automotive technology, traditional fuel vehicles are also gradually becoming electrified and intelligent. Although relays are relatively rarely used in fuel vehicles, their basic principles and roles cannot be ignored. In the electrical system of fuel vehicles, relays also play a role in switch control and protection to ensure the normal operation of the vehicle's electrical system. 

To sum up, relays play an important role in new energy vehicles, especially in high- voltage circuit control and electrical system protection. Compared with traditional fuel vehicles, the demand for relays in new energy vehicles is more complex and diverse, and it also puts forward higher requirements for the performance and quality of relays. With the continuous expansion of the new energy vehicle market and the continuous innovation of technology, relays, as key control components, will play an increasingly important role in the field of new energy vehicles.
